#b6c648 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#b6c648 is composed of 71.4% red, 77.6% green and 28.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 8.1% cyan, 0% magenta, 63.6% yellow and 22.4% black. It has a hue angle of 67.6 degrees, a saturation of 52.5% and a lightness of 52.9%. #b6c648 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ff90 with #6d8d00. Closest websafe color is: #cccc33.

#b6c648 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#b6c648 has RGB values of R:182, G:198, B:72 and CMYK values of C:0.08, M:0, Y:0.64, K:0.22. Its decimal value is 11978312.

Shades and Tints of #b6c648
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0a0b04 is the darkest color, while #fefefb is the lightest one.

Tones of #b6c648
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#8d8f7f is the less saturated color, while #dffd11 is the most saturated one.
